... |
... |
@@ -8,15 +8,11 @@ |
8 |
8 |
|
9 |
9 |
== ๐ Table of Contents: == |
10 |
10 |
|
11 |
|
-* [[Editing with the WYSIWYG Editor>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#editing-pages]] |
12 |
|
-* [[Inserting Attachments and Images>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#attachments]] |
13 |
|
-* [[Using the / Macro Shortcut>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#macros]] |
14 |
|
-* [[Basic Formatting and Links>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#formatting]] |
15 |
|
-* [[Useful Tips>>https://chatgpt.com/c/67d66d62-3244-800a-8974-570f38118948#tips]] |
|
11 |
+{{toc/}} |
16 |
16 |
|
17 |
17 |
---- |
18 |
18 |
|
19 |
|
-== ๐ Attachments and Images == |
|
15 |
+== ๐ **Attachments and Images** == |
20 |
20 |
|
21 |
21 |
You can easily upload files and images directly from the WYSIWYG editor: |
22 |
22 |
|
... |
... |
@@ -27,7 +27,7 @@ |
27 |
27 |
* Drag-and-drop or select your file to upload it instantly. |
28 |
28 |
* Uploaded files will automatically be listed as attachments at the bottom of your page. |
29 |
29 |
|
30 |
|
-=== Inserting Images with Enlargable Thumbnails === |
|
26 |
+=== **Inserting Images with Enlargable Thumbnails** === |
31 |
31 |
|
32 |
32 |
1. In the editor, click the **"Insert Image"** icon from the toolbar. |
33 |
33 |
1. Upload or select the image. |
... |
... |
@@ -35,7 +35,7 @@ |
35 |
35 |
|
36 |
36 |
---- |
37 |
37 |
|
38 |
|
-== โก Using the / Macro Shortcut == |
|
34 |
+== โก **Using the / Macro Shortcut** == |
39 |
39 |
|
40 |
40 |
The / macro shortcut is a powerful and quick way to insert macros while editing pages in XWiki's WYSIWYG editor: |
41 |
41 |
|
... |
... |
@@ -52,7 +52,7 @@ |
52 |
52 |
|
53 |
53 |
---- |
54 |
54 |
|
55 |
|
-== โ๏ธ Basic Formatting and Links (Quick Guide) == |
|
51 |
+== โ๏ธ**ย Basic Formatting and Links (Quick Guide)** == |
56 |
56 |
|
57 |
57 |
* **Bold text**: Select text, click the **Bold** button or press Ctrl + B. |
58 |
58 |
* **Italic text**: Select text, click "Italic" in the toolbar or use Ctrl+I. |
... |
... |
@@ -62,7 +62,7 @@ |
62 |
62 |
|
63 |
63 |
---- |
64 |
64 |
|
65 |
|
-== ๐ Useful Tips & Best Practices == |
|
61 |
+== ๐ **Useful Tips & Best Practices** == |
66 |
66 |
|
67 |
67 |
* **Save drafts frequently:** Press Ctrl+S regularly. |
68 |
68 |
* **Macros** greatly simplify content formattingโuse / often. |
... |
... |
@@ -71,42 +71,41 @@ |
71 |
71 |
|
72 |
72 |
---- |
73 |
73 |
|
74 |
|
-= โกGuests can contribute = |
|
70 |
+= โก**Guests can contribute** = |
75 |
75 |
|
76 |
76 |
1. Guests can edit pages in the main content area without signing up. If this becomes problematic I'll change it but for now I'd like everyone to have access with as little trouble as possible. |
77 |
77 |
1. Use Your Sandbox on the left, mess around with macros and other editing options. There's a lot of options to customize content. |
78 |
78 |
1. Leave comments, give suggestions, request features. |
79 |
79 |
|
80 |
|
-== Content Guidelines == |
|
76 |
+== **Content Guidelines** == |
81 |
81 |
|
82 |
82 |
* Ensure your content is well-researched, you don't need to include references in the format of footnotes for your material, but you should try to include studies or links to give credibility to your claims. For instance, just claiming that [[IQ is genetic>>doc:Main Categories.Science & Research.Race & IQ.WebHome]] is genetic wouldn't be valid unless you provide a study backing up that assertion, or more likely link to a page within this site that explains why IQ is not something that is purely determined by environmental factors. If such a page doesn't exist, create it, and start providing studies that show this. |
83 |
83 |
* Use clear, concise language and avoid using slurs, slang, or troll like language. This isn't supposed to be encyclopedia dramatica, I'd like things to remain relatively mature and well thought out. |
84 |
84 |
|
85 |
|
-== Directories and Page URLs == |
|
81 |
+== **Directories and Page URLs** == |
86 |
86 |
|
87 |
87 |
* The categories I have made up should cover most content, but if you feel your content doesn't fit under them, feel free to make a new category. Moving pages and reorganizing content in this wiki is very easy. |
88 |
88 |
|
89 |
|
-Hereโs a consolidated guide tailored for your XWiki environment, integrating essential syntax, formatting options, and an overview of notable macros to enhance content creation and management.๎ |
90 |
90 |
|
91 |
|
-**1. XWiki Editing Modes** |
92 |
92 |
|
|
87 |
+== **XWiki Editing Modes** == |
|
88 |
+ |
93 |
93 |
XWiki offers multiple editing modes to accommodate various user preferences and technical requirements:๎ |
94 |
94 |
|
95 |
|
-*. **WYSIWYG (What You See Is What You Get) Editor**: Ideal for users unfamiliar with wiki syntax, this editor provides a user-friendly interface resembling traditional word processors. It allows for straightforward text formatting, image insertion, and link creation without delving into markup language. ๎cite๎turn0search0๎๎ |
96 |
|
-*. **Wiki Editor**: This mode enables direct editing using XWikiโs markup syntax. Itโs suitable for users comfortable with wiki syntax and those requiring precise control over the content structure.๎ |
97 |
|
-*. **Inline Form Editing**: Used primarily for pages containing structured data or custom applications, this mode presents editable fields directly within the page view, streamlining data entry and updates.๎ |
|
91 |
+* **WYSIWYG (What You See Is What You Get) Editor**: Ideal for users unfamiliar with wiki syntax, this editor provides a user-friendly interface resembling traditional word processors. It allows for straightforward text formatting, image insertion, and link creation without delving into markup language. ๎cite๎turn0search0๎๎ |
|
92 |
+* **Wiki Editor**: This mode enables direct editing using XWikiโs markup syntax. Itโs suitable for users comfortable with wiki syntax and those requiring precise control over the content structure.๎ |
|
93 |
+* **Inline Form Editing**: Used primarily for pages containing structured data or custom applications, this mode presents editable fields directly within the page view, streamlining data entry and updates.๎ |
98 |
98 |
|
99 |
|
-**Switching Between Syntaxes** |
|
95 |
+=== **Switching Between Syntaxes** === |
100 |
100 |
|
101 |
101 |
XWiki supports multiple syntaxes, including XWiki 2.1, MediaWiki, and others. While itโs possible to switch a pageโs syntax, exercise caution, as certain syntaxes may not fully support WYSIWYG editing. For instance, changing a page to MediaWiki syntax might limit the availability of the WYSIWYG editor. ๎cite๎turn0search6๎๎ |
102 |
102 |
|
103 |
|
-**2. Essential Formatting Options** |
|
99 |
+== **Essential Formatting Options** == |
104 |
104 |
|
105 |
105 |
To ensure content is both engaging and accessible, utilize the following formatting techniques:๎ |
106 |
106 |
|
107 |
|
-*. **Headings**: Organize content hierarchically using headings. In XWiki syntax, headings are defined by one to six plus signs (+), corresponding to heading levels 1 to 6.๎ |
|
103 |
+* **Headings**: Organize content hierarchically using headings. In XWiki syntax, headings are defined by one to six plus signs (+), corresponding to heading levels 1 to 6.๎ |
108 |
108 |
|
109 |
|
- |
110 |
110 |
{{code}} |
111 |
111 |
+ Heading Level 1 |
112 |
112 |
++ Heading Level 2 |
... |
... |
@@ -113,74 +113,97 @@ |
113 |
113 |
+++ Heading Level 3 |
114 |
114 |
{{/code}} |
115 |
115 |
|
116 |
|
-๎ |
117 |
117 |
|
118 |
|
-*. **Text Formatting**: Apply styles such as bold, italics, and underlining to emphasize text.๎ |
|
112 |
+=== **Text Formatting** === |
119 |
119 |
|
120 |
|
-**. **Bold**: Surround text with double asterisks.๎ |
121 |
121 |
|
122 |
122 |
|
|
116 |
+* |
|
117 |
+** ((( |
|
118 |
+=== **Bold**: Surround text with double asterisks. === |
|
119 |
+))) |
|
120 |
+ |
123 |
123 |
{{code}} |
124 |
124 |
**bold text** |
125 |
125 |
{{/code}} |
126 |
|
-**. **Italics**: Use double underscores.๎ |
127 |
127 |
|
128 |
128 |
|
|
126 |
+* |
|
127 |
+** ((( |
|
128 |
+=== **Italics**: Use double underscores. === |
|
129 |
+))) |
|
130 |
+ |
129 |
129 |
{{code}} |
130 |
130 |
__italic text__ |
131 |
131 |
{{/code}} |
132 |
|
-**. **Underline**: Enclose text with double tildes.๎ |
133 |
133 |
|
134 |
134 |
|
|
136 |
+* |
|
137 |
+** ((( |
|
138 |
+=== **Underline**: Enclose text with double tildes. === |
|
139 |
+))) |
|
140 |
+ |
135 |
135 |
{{code}} |
136 |
136 |
~~underlined text~~ |
137 |
137 |
{{/code}} |
138 |
|
-*. **Lists**: Create ordered and unordered lists for structured information.๎ |
139 |
139 |
|
140 |
|
-**. **Unordered List**: Begin lines with asterisk (*) or hyphen (-).๎ |
141 |
141 |
|
|
146 |
+* |
|
147 |
+** ((( |
|
148 |
+=== **Unordered List**: Begin lines with asterisk (*) or hyphen (-). === |
|
149 |
+))) |
142 |
142 |
|
143 |
143 |
{{code}} |
144 |
144 |
* Item 1 |
145 |
145 |
* Item 2 |
146 |
146 |
{{/code}} |
147 |
|
-**. **Ordered List**: Start lines with a number followed by a period.๎ |
148 |
148 |
|
149 |
149 |
|
|
157 |
+* |
|
158 |
+** ((( |
|
159 |
+=== **Ordered List**: Start lines with a number followed by a period. === |
|
160 |
+))) |
|
161 |
+ |
150 |
150 |
{{code}} |
151 |
151 |
1. First item |
152 |
152 |
2. Second item |
153 |
153 |
{{/code}} |
154 |
|
-*. **Links**: Insert internal and external links to connect related content.๎ |
155 |
155 |
|
156 |
|
-**. **Internal Link**: Use square brackets with the page name.๎ |
157 |
157 |
|
|
168 |
+== **Links** == |
158 |
158 |
|
|
170 |
+ |
|
171 |
+ |
|
172 |
+==== ** Internal Link**: Use square brackets with the page name. ==== |
|
173 |
+ |
159 |
159 |
{{code}} |
160 |
160 |
[[PageName]] |
161 |
161 |
{{/code}} |
162 |
|
-**. **External Link**: Provide the URL directly.๎ |
163 |
163 |
|
|
178 |
+* |
|
179 |
+** ((( |
|
180 |
+==== **External Link**: Provide the URL directly. ==== |
|
181 |
+))) |
164 |
164 |
|
165 |
165 |
{{code}} |
166 |
166 |
[https://www.example.com] |
167 |
167 |
{{/code}} |
168 |
|
-*. **Images**: Embed images to enrich content.๎ |
169 |
169 |
|
|
187 |
+* ((( |
|
188 |
+=== **Images** === |
|
189 |
+))) |
170 |
170 |
|
171 |
171 |
{{code}} |
172 |
172 |
[[image:example.jpg]] |
173 |
173 |
{{/code}} |
174 |
174 |
|
175 |
|
-๎ |
176 |
176 |
|
177 |
|
-**3. Utilizing XWiki Macros** |
|
196 |
+== **Utilizing XWiki Macros** == |
178 |
178 |
|
179 |
179 |
Macros are powerful tools in XWiki that allow for dynamic content inclusion and advanced formatting. Here are ten notable macros to consider:๎ |
180 |
180 |
|
181 |
|
-1. **Box Macro**: Encapsulates content within a styled box, useful for highlighting information.๎ |
|
200 |
+**Box Macro**: Encapsulates content within a styled box, useful for highlighting information. |
182 |
182 |
|
183 |
|
- |
184 |
184 |
{{code}} |
185 |
185 |
{{box}} |
186 |
186 |
Your content here. |
... |
... |
@@ -187,9 +187,8 @@ |
187 |
187 |
{{/box}} |
188 |
188 |
{{/code}} |
189 |
189 |
|
190 |
|
-๎ |
191 |
|
-1. **Info Macro**: Displays an informational message, often used for tips or notes.๎ |
192 |
192 |
|
|
209 |
+=== **Info Macro**: Displays an informational message, often used for tips or notes. === |
193 |
193 |
|
194 |
194 |
{{code}} |
195 |
195 |
{{info}} |
... |
... |
@@ -197,9 +197,8 @@ |
197 |
197 |
{{/info}} |
198 |
198 |
{{/code}} |
199 |
199 |
|
200 |
|
-๎ |
201 |
|
-1. **Warning Macro**: Highlights warnings or important notices.๎ |
202 |
202 |
|
|
218 |
+=== **Warning Macro**: Highlights warnings or important notices. === |
203 |
203 |
|
204 |
204 |
{{code}} |
205 |
205 |
{{warning}} |
... |
... |
@@ -207,9 +207,8 @@ |
207 |
207 |
{{/warning}} |
208 |
208 |
{{/code}} |
209 |
209 |
|
210 |
|
-๎ |
211 |
|
-1. **Code Macro**: Renders code snippets with syntax highlighting.๎ |
212 |
212 |
|
|
227 |
+=== **Code Macro**: Renders code snippets with syntax highlighting. === |
213 |
213 |
|
214 |
214 |
{{code}} |
215 |
215 |
{{code language="python"}} |
... |
... |
@@ -218,9 +218,8 @@ |
218 |
218 |
{{/code}} |
219 |
219 |
{{/code}} |
220 |
220 |
|
221 |
|
-๎ |
222 |
|
-1. **Gallery Macro**: Creates an image gallery from attached images.๎ |
223 |
223 |
|
|
237 |
+=== **Gallery Macro**: Creates an image gallery from attached images. === |
224 |
224 |
|
225 |
225 |
{{code}} |
226 |
226 |
{{gallery}} |
... |
... |
@@ -229,33 +229,29 @@ |
229 |
229 |
{{/gallery}} |
230 |
230 |
{{/code}} |
231 |
231 |
|
232 |
|
-๎ |
233 |
|
-1. **TOC (Table of Contents) Macro**: Generates a table of contents based on page headings.๎ |
234 |
234 |
|
|
247 |
+=== **TOC (Table of Contents) Macro**: Generates a table of contents based on page headings. === |
235 |
235 |
|
236 |
236 |
{{code}} |
237 |
237 |
{{toc/}} |
238 |
238 |
{{/code}} |
239 |
239 |
|
240 |
|
-๎ |
241 |
|
-1. **Include Macro**: Embeds content from another page.๎ |
242 |
242 |
|
|
254 |
+=== **Include Macro**: Embeds content from another page. === |
243 |
243 |
|
244 |
244 |
{{code}} |
245 |
245 |
{{include reference="PageName"/}} |
246 |
246 |
{{/code}} |
247 |
247 |
|
248 |
|
-๎ |
249 |
|
-1. **Display Macro**: Displays the content of another document or an object property.๎ |
250 |
250 |
|
|
261 |
+=== **Display Macro**: Displays the content of another document or an object property. === |
251 |
251 |
|
252 |
252 |
{{code}} |
253 |
253 |
{{display reference="PageName"/}} |
254 |
254 |
{{/code}} |
255 |
255 |
|
256 |
|
-๎ |
257 |
|
-1. **Velocity Macro**: Executes Velocity scripts for dynamic content generation.๎ |
258 |
258 |
|
|
268 |
+=== **Velocity Macro**: Executes Velocity scripts for dynamic content generation. === |
259 |
259 |
|
260 |
260 |
{{code}} |
261 |
261 |
{{velocity}} |
... |
... |
@@ -264,5 +264,4 @@ |
264 |
264 |
{{/velocity}} |
265 |
265 |
{{/code}} |
266 |
266 |
|
267 |
|
-๎ |
268 |
|
-1. **HTML Macro**: Allows the inclusion of |
|
277 |
+ |